#37: Use public database interface; fixes graupel on ownCloud 9
[grauphel.git] / appinfo / app.php
index b3c2b4686846846f1e1293ad37b801c30fb441a9..afbc7879f78ff9ffd9ae766ebb5395034fab9291 100755 (executable)
@@ -1,13 +1,17 @@
 <?php
 <?php
-//OCP\App::registerAdmin( 'apptemplate', 'settings' );
-
-OCP\App::addNavigationEntry(
+\OC::$server->getNavigationManager()->add(
     array( 
         'id' => 'grauphel',
         'order' => 2342,
         'href' => \OCP\Util::linkToRoute('grauphel.gui.index'),
     array( 
         'id' => 'grauphel',
         'order' => 2342,
         'href' => \OCP\Util::linkToRoute('grauphel.gui.index'),
-        'icon' => OCP\Util::imagePath('grauphel', 'notes.png'),
+        'icon' => \OCP\Util::imagePath('grauphel', 'app.svg'),
         'name' => 'Tomboy notes'
     )
 );
         'name' => 'Tomboy notes'
     )
 );
+
+\OC::$server->getSearch()->registerProvider(
+    'OCA\Grauphel\Search\Provider', array('apps' => array('grauphel'))
+);
+
+\OCP\Util::addscript('grauphel', 'loader');
 ?>
 ?>